What does the Patriot Act have to do with buying a car?

If you pay with cash or pre-arranged financing, dealers have no right to try to make you consent to a credit check by the USA PATRIOT Act, which is a federal anti-terrorism law, or any other law. To make matters worse for the consumer, most people don’t even know what the USA PATRIOT Act even is.

How many times does a dealership run your credit?

Each rate quote, however, requires the lender to run its own hard credit inquiry. Thus, a single auto loan application made to a single auto dealership can realistically trigger 10 to 20 (and possibly even more) hard credit inquiries on a consumer’s credit report.

How much can you talk a dealer down on a new car?

For an average car, 2% above the dealer’s invoice price is a reasonably good deal. A hot-selling car may have little room for negotiation, while you may be able to go even lower with a slow-selling model. Salespeople will usually try to negotiate based on the MSRP.

Whats a good APR for a car?

An auto loan’s interest rate will depend largely on your credit score. Those with a credit score between 781 and 850 saw an average new car interest rate of 2.4% in the first quarter of 2022. Meanwhile, borrowers with scores in the lowest range (300 to 500) saw average rates of 14.76%.
